What is the working principle of ml type plum blossom elastic coupling:
The plum blossom elastic coupling consists of a plum blossom elastic pad made of rubber or polyurethane and two convex claws of the half coupling with the same shape. The elastic pad is installed between the two half-couplings to complete the connection. The power is transmitted through the extrusion between the convex claw and the elastic pad. At the same time, the relative offset of the two shafts is compensated by the elastic deformation of the elastic pad to achieve the effect of damping and buffering. . What are the materials of the ml-type plum blossom elastic coupling:
The main materials of the plum blossom elastic coupling are: No. 45 steel, 40CrMo, stainless steel, cast steel, cast iron, aluminum alloy, etc. Among them, No. 45 steel is used more in large-scale machinery and equipment, while aluminum alloy material is used in precision more on type devices. In addition, the elastic pads in the middle are mostly polyurethane, nylon and rubber. In contrast, there will be more polyurethane because the price is cheap.

After reading the working principle of the ml-type plum blossom elastic coupling introduced above, we can all find that the elastic pad in the middle of the coupling is its important part. In ordinary occasions, polyurethane material can meet the needs. Rubber and nylon are two kinds of better quality, and the buffering and transmission effects are also better.
